Lecture XIX: Heat Flow, Optimal Transport and Ricci Curvature

In this final lecture we wish to explore the connections between Heat Flow, Optimal Transport and Ricci curvature on a smooth compact Riemannian manifold. In doing so we will extend and generalise some of the properties we have proved for the Euclidean space. Let us recall that, in particular, we have established the convexity of the logarithmic entropy in \((\mathcal {P}_2(\mathbb {R}^n),W_2)\) in Theorem 15.16 and the fact that the heat flow (defined as the \(L^2\) gradient flow of the Dirichlet energy) is an \( \operatorname {\mathrm {EVI}}\) gradient flow of the relative entropy in \((\mathcal {P}_2(\mathbb {R}^n),W_2)\) .
